Curling or Fastening Tiles
Occasionally, you could observe curling or distorting tiles on your roof covering, which's a clear indication something's incorrect. This issue usually suggests that your tiles are aging or have actually been jeopardized. When tiles crinkle, they shed their effectiveness, allowing water to permeate underneath them, possibly causing leaks and additional damages.
You must focus on whether the curling is happening at the edges or in the middle of the tiles. Edges curling upwards suggest that your shingles are drying out, while those crinkling downwards might show moisture issues below the surface.
Twisting shingles, on the other hand, might signify that your roof's underlayment isn't offering proper assistance, which can cause structural issues with time.

Granules in Gutters
Granules in your rain gutters can indicate that your roof is nearing the end of its life expectancy. These tiny, loosened particles typically originate from asphalt tiles, which naturally wear down over time. If you discover a build-up of granules, it's a sign that your shingles are wearing away and might no more be offering sufficient security for your home.
As you evaluate your rain gutters, take notice of the amount of granules present. A few granules occasionally can be typical, particularly after a storm. Nonetheless, if you discover a significant build-up or if your rain gutters are consistently loaded with these particles, it's time to do something about it.
Granules offer a critical function-- they help secure your tiles from UV rays and add to their overall sturdiness. When they start to remove, your roofing ends up being a lot more susceptible to damages.

Roof Age
The lifespan of your roofing plays an important duty in establishing whether it needs substitute. Many roof coverings last in between 20 to three decades, relying on the products used and local climate conditions. If your roofing system is nearing or has surpassed this age, it's time to take into consideration a substitute.
You mightn't need to wait for noticeable damage to make a decision. Routine evaluations can help you capture any kind of potential problems early. If you understand the age of your roof covering and it's coming close to completion of its life-span, stay proactive. Look for indicators of wear and tear, such as curling roof shingles or granule loss.
Likewise, consider the kind of roofing product you have. Asphalt roof shingles, as an example, may wear faster than metal or floor tile roofing systems.
